Miah Zavarro
21 month y.o. female
2’7” / 10.4kgs (BMI 16.8)
C/O Swollen Hands / Feet
V/S: BP 90/58; T 98.6; HR 134; RR 28; Ox 98%
Interview Progress: 0/5
Progress: C/C Sx:
Associated Symptoms:
PMH:
SH:
Etiology:
ROS:

Questions:

Interview Opening:
 How can I help you today?


HPI:
 Has she had swelling like this before?
a. Similar episodes at 6 and 11 months; seems like every 4 months
 What do you think has caused this to happen?
 Any other symptoms or concerns we should discuss?
a. Decreased appetite & swollen belly
 When did her swelling start?
a. 2 days ago
 Is there any pattern to when her selling occurs?
a. Following colds
 Has there been any changes in her swelling problem over time?
a. Not really, just seems severe this time
 Where more precisely is the swelling
a. Hands and feet
 Does anything make her swelling problem better or worse?
a. Improves with rest, fluids, motrin, and time
 Has she noticed swelling in any part of her body?
a. Yes hands and feet
 What treatment has she had for her swelling problems?
a. Motrin, rest, and fluids
 How severe is her swelling
a. Severe
 Is her swelling problem better or worse at any time of day, week, or year
a. I don’t know but she’s had this before
 How long doe her swelling last?
